Good evening wahoo8897.

 

I'm just back from sailing on Liberty on her 5th October sailing from Barcelona around the Med so the information I have may differ from what actually happens due to the differing itineraries. They did indeed have movies on the top deck in the evening. The times varied from night to night if i recall rightly so you should get to watch something at least once. Although we didn't watch anything this year, last year we did and it was sing-a-long Grease. Okay if you like that kind of thing. This year I think it could have been Captain America one of the nights. I would recommend getting a drink or two before you head up to the top deck, the pool bars are closed and the nearest bar was Olive or Twist, okay if your just relaxing on the loungers but if your planning on getting in the jacuzzi and getting wet, its not so good. As I say though, the pool bars may well be open on the caribbean itineraries.

There were movies on a few nights. We saw Edge of Tomorrow one night and Ghostbusters was on another night, both starting at around10. Planes 2 was on two nights at 8. btpw92 makes a good point, there is no service attached. I understand Princess make a big thing of blankets and popcorn, no such pampering on Liberty. They stick on the movie and good luck after that!
